For this full-size artificial turf field, my role was modeling and documenting the design under direction of other team members. The 70′ clear kicking height presented challenges that were coordinated with the structural engineer and steel detailer through Revit and Tekla. Detailed research with glazing and curtainwall manufacturers was necessary to achieve the designed look. During construction, I served as the main point of contact for architectural administration. I used Revit to handle revisions, questions, conflicts, and gaps.
